We have reached the end of the Hijri year of 1445 AH and the end of the sacred month of Dhul Hijjah. For those who began the month with the Saudi Arabian sighting, this day of July 5, 2024, corresponds with the 29th of Dhul Hijjah 1445 AH. According to the twitter account @HaramainInfo, the hilal was not sighted. They will begin the new year on the evening of July 6, 2024, with the first day of Muharram 1446 AH being July 07, 2024. In the United States of America and Canada, there has always been a difference of opinion in approach to determining the months of the Hijri calendar with some organizations following Saudi Arabia’s sightings, others following local or regional sighting, others following astronomical calculations and others combining the methodologies. This year many masajid and organizations chose to follow Saudi Arabia’s sighting of the hilal of Dhul Hijjah. The striking question is how will these organizations determine the new month of Muharram and with the new year?

Scholarly organizations such as the Fiqh Council of North America (FCNA) have explicitly stated that they determine the months of the Hijri calendar via “precise” calculations under a particular astronomical criterion, however for Dhul Hijjah and Eid Al Adha, they defer to the Supreme Court of Saudi Arabia. The pressure to follow the international sighting for the start of Dhul Hijjah and reasoning due to the Hajj was strong . Now that the Hajj is over and the month is ending, it is important that organizations have a method to determine the next month and year. Organizations and masajid that are truly following the method of international sighting should be surveying news for an international sighting and preparing their communities and networks to sight the hilal tonight. Organizations like the FCNA that combine methodologies will ultimately use their rubric. According to the FCNA, the first day of Muharram will be on July 07, 2024, based upon astronomical calculations. Organizations, communities and masajid that follow regional and/or local sightings will be determining the new month based upon their respective methodologies.

The Green Islamic Foundation has established its determination of the Hijri calendar on naked eye regional sightings from the approach taught in the madhab of Imam Malik. We began the month on June 08, 2024, therefore making today the 28th of Dhul Hijjah 1445 AH. We will begin searching for the hilal on the evening of July 06, 2024.
